In episode 227 Jo's special guest is Claire Carroll, a photographer who specialises in wildlife, children's portraits and ultra modern buildings. She talks about her passion for photography, including a recent exhibition and she answers the Quick Six.
Jo also visits the Holst Victorian House to find out the story behind a recent acquisition for the museum - a piano that dates to the time composer Gustav Holst was growing up in the house.
